DIVE SPOT ASIA is located at the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ort. which is situated between the small, picturesque towns of Alcoy and Boljoon, in the southeastern part of the beautiful island of Cebu, just 95 km away from Cebu City, making it a wonderful spot for scuba diving in Cebu. Far away from famous tourist centers, DIVE SPOT ASIA is a place where you can discover the natural beauty of this wonderful island. Whether you’re a diver, adventurer or nature lover, you will find everything that you are looking for and everything that you need, most especially an unforgettable experience while diving in Cebu. Many of South Cebu’s sightseeing highlights can easily be reached due to a good connection to the main coastal road.

A peaceful hotel where you cannot find to many rooms so if you are tired to big hotels this is a positive one since it is quite familiar (We were looking for that). The Staff were so helpful and lovely, they arranged quickly for a rental motorbike and a private van for our transfer to the airport. The hotel has a bamboo platform in front of the sea where you can enjoy a perfect massage with privacy (100% Recommended) The Wifi was one of the best ones that I had in Philippines (I was in 7 hotels during my stay) also the breakfast was one of my favourites. The room is nice and the balcony is lovely to have some fresh air, they have a mosquito net in the door of the balcony so you can sleep all night with the windows open an enjoy of sound of the sea (AMAZING). I didn't have time for diving but if you are willing to do it, the instructors are really nice and for the pictures seen in Instagram seems a really good place to do it. I would like to add something negative, it is 3 hours far from the airport and the mattress could be better. The Hotel is quite new and they are still doing some works so I would like to say some things to improve it, since I loved the Hotel: 1) A hairdryer could be add in the bedroom. 2) A water fountain in the area of the rooms will be great. 3) A flyer with activities to do like, massages, visits to waterfalls etc 4) A van with Airport transport will be great since it is quite expensive to get there by Taxi. This hotel was the one on the middle of our full trip in Philippines and was GREAT to disconnect and relax. It is just what we need it. WE WILL COME BACK 100%.

Frequently Asked Questions about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ort
Which popular attractions are close to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Nearby attractions include Boljoon Parish Museum (3.2 km), Patrocinio de Maria Church (3.2 km), and Tingko Beach (7.0 km).
What are some of the property amenities at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Some of the more popular amenities offered include free wifi, free breakfast, and an on-site restaurant.
What food & drink options are available at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Guests can enjoy free breakfast, an on-site restaurant, and a lounge during their stay.
Is parking available at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Yes, free parking is available to guests.
What are some restaurants close to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Conveniently located restaurants include Noordzee Restobar, Voda Krasna Resort & Restaurant, and The Breeze.
Does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ort have airport transportation?
Yes,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ort offers airport transportation for guests. We recommend calling ahead to confirm details.
Are there any historical sites close to Dive Spot Asia Beach Resort?
Many travellers enjoy visiting Obong Watchtower (9.8 km).
